
The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ques, King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ud of Saudi Arabia, chaired the Cabinet session at Al-Salam Palace in Jeddah on Monday.
In a statement to the Saudi Press Agency, SPA, the Saudi Minister of State, Cabinet Member and Acting Minister of Culture and Information, Dr. Essam bin Saad bin Saeed, said that the cabinet reviewed a number of reports on the latest developments of events in the region and the world, stressing the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ia's support for all judicial measures taken by the Kingdom of Bahrain to fight extremism and terrorism in all its forms and manifestations, reiterating Saudi Arabia's solidarity and standing by Bahrain in the measures taken to preserve the security, stability and safety of its citizens, and to safeguard Bahrain's unity and social
